What is a Cloud Server?
A cloud server is a virtual server that operates in a cloud computing environment, providing users with on-demand access to computing resources over the internet. Unlike traditional physical servers, cloud servers are not confined to a single physical location. Instead, they are hosted on multiple servers that work together to create a virtual infrastructure, allowing for greater flexibility and scalability.
In simple terms, a cloud server is like renting a space on a large, shared network of servers. This network can be accessed from anywhere, at any time, and provides users with the computing power and storage they need to run their applications, websites, or services.
Advantages of Cloud Servers
1、Scalability: One of the most significant advantages of cloud servers is their scalability. Users can easily scale up or down their resources based on their current needs, ensuring they only pay for what they use.
2、Cost-Effectiveness: Cloud servers eliminate the need for expensive hardware and infrastructure investments. Users can opt for a pay-as-you-go model, reducing upfront costs and operational expenses.
3、High Availability: Cloud servers are designed to be highly available, meaning they are always accessible and can handle high traffic loads without downtime.
4、Flexibility: Cloud servers can be accessed from anywhere with an internet connection, allowing for remote work and collaboration.
5、Disaster Recovery: Cloud servers offer robust disaster recovery solutions, ensuring that data and applications are backed up and can be quickly restored in the event of a disaster.
6、Automatic Updates: Cloud service providers typically handle server maintenance and updates, ensuring that users always have access to the latest software and security patches.
Features of Cloud Servers
1、Virtualization: Cloud servers are built on virtualization technology, which allows multiple virtual machines (VMs) to run on a single physical server. This maximizes resource utilization and provides isolation between VMs.
2、Self-Service Portal: Users can manage their cloud servers through a self-service portal, which allows them to provision, configure, and monitor their resources without requiring technical expertise.
3、Resource Allocation: Cloud servers offer flexible resource allocation, including CPU, memory, storage, and bandwidth. Users can choose the resources that best meet their requirements.
4、Distributed Storage: Cloud servers typically utilize distributed storage solutions, ensuring high performance, redundancy, and data protection.
5、Backup and Restore: Cloud servers provide automated backup and restore functionalities, ensuring that data is protected and can be quickly recovered.
6、High-Speed Connectivity: Cloud servers are connected to high-speed networks, providing fast data transfer rates and low latency.
Characteristics of Cloud Servers
1、On-Demand Access: Cloud servers can be accessed on-demand, allowing users to quickly provision and deploy resources as needed.
2、Self-Healing: Cloud servers often have self-healing capabilities, which automatically detect and resolve issues such as hardware failures or network disruptions.
3、Elasticity: Cloud servers are highly elastic, meaning they can dynamically adjust to changing workloads, ensuring optimal performance and resource utilization.
4、Global Reach: Cloud servers are typically hosted in multiple data centers around the world, providing users with access to resources from any location.
5、Security: Cloud servers offer robust security measures, including firewalls, encryption, and intrusion detection systems, to protect data and applications from unauthorized access.
6、Compliance: Cloud service providers often adhere to industry regulations and standards, ensuring that cloud servers meet the necessary compliance requirements.
